// Crash-report pipeline constants (Pebblewing ingest tier).
// Reports arrive from the Lanternfall mobile SDK in gzipped batches;
// we debounce duplicate stack hashes before forwarding to triage.
// Reviewers: the retry window must stay shorter than the SDK's
// client-side resend interval or we double-count crashes. Queue
// depth caps were sized against the worst spike we saw during the
// Marrowgate launch. Do not raise batch size without re-running the
// dedupe soak test. The tuning constants are defined immediately below.

constants for kawef-bawif:
TIERS = {
    "oliir": 236,
    "lamion": 438,
    "pelmir": 279,
}

QUARTERLY PLANNING NOTE — Branch Managers

Hi folks — as promised at the Ashgrove offsite, here's the scoop on the revised commission scheme for next quarter. We're simplifying: one blended rate instead of the old product-by-product mess, plus a team bonus when a branch clears its quarterly target. Renewals now count at half weight, so push new logos. Payouts shift to monthly, which should help morale. Run the numbers with your senior reps before the kickoff call. For context, our wider plan is summarized below.

board note of kageg-bahof: The renewal with Holwynax Holdings closes at $2 million a year, 5 percent below the last contract. Project Ulaath slips by two quarters because of the supplier delay.

// QUEUE_DEPTH_SCALE_THRESHOLD: backlog size at which the Marmot
// autoscaler adds workers. Security note: this value is read only from
// the signed config bundle at boot; runtime overrides via the admin
// socket were removed in the last audit cycle, so there is no unauthenticated
// path to force a scale-out and exhaust quota. Changes must go through the
// standard config-signing pipeline. The signed build carrying this
// constant is identified by the token below.

session token of tajef-bageg = htk21_5d90d574934f3ccae6437

// VRAMSCOPE_SAMPLE_INTERVAL_MS
// Controls how often the Vramscope profiler polls the Kestrelite driver
// for per-allocation GPU memory statistics. Lowering this below 50ms
// caused measurable frame stutter on the Oxhollow test rigs, so any
// change must be validated against the full capture suite before a
// release is cut. Release manager: please confirm this value matches
// the one baked into the profiling sidecar, since a mismatch silently
// skews heap deltas. The build token for the validated pairing follows
// immediately below.

pipeline stamp: htk9_ce63042d9